BIOMONITORING OF TRACE METALS IN AIR AT DIFFERENT LOCATIONS OF LUCKNOW, INDIA

ROHIT KUMAR AND S.N. PANDEY

Abstract

Lichen (Pyxine cocos) plants were transplanted at four sites of Lucknow city of high vehicular activities. One set of lichen was also transplanted in the area with negligible vehicular activities (L1). Lichen accumulated elevated level of trace metals observed after transplantation at all polluted sites in their tissues. Maximum tissue concentration of Fe (554 ?g g-¹dry weight ) was observed at 15 days after transplantation. The tissue accumulation of trace metals was found in the order Fe > Zn> Pb > Cu > Cr in lichen transplanted at different areas with high vehicles load in Lucknow. Least tissue concentration of trace metals was found in lichens transplanted in relatively uncontaminated area (L1). Study indicated elevated trace metal contents in ambient air possibly due to the high vehicular pollution in the Lucknow city, needs careful measures to control high vehicular activities.
